The Polar Clan Initiative is a small group of artists, makers, musicians, and engineers that create and share their crafts and adventures. Local artists create works of art, share their personal journeys, share their musical talent, or grow and cultivate with a maker mentality. All to support themselves and nurture their creative talents. The purpose of the Polar Clan Initiative website is to create an online gallery space to highlight local artists works, and provide a mechanism for supporters to purchase work from those artists. The website will eventually provide a marketing channel, an ecommerce solution, as well as a networking community. There will be monthly gallery changes to allow for frequent introductions and attractions, while still maintaining highlights and attractive marketing for previous featured artists. During the project, I researched great art gallery websites. I found several highly rated sites in a few digital art magazines, and found inspiration in elements upon visiting those sites. I also read several articles discussing artist websites, and the best design philosophy for this type of site. This lead to the neutral, white-box, showcasing nature of the Polar Clan Initiative site design.
B. Defense of the Final Product
The general page design for the Polar Clan Initiative website follows the same wireframe throughout the site. This will help the user to navigate the site more easily. The Polar Clan Initiative logo will stay focused in the upper left-hand corner. The search box will appear in the upper right-hand corner of the site. The footer will contain links to special pages and will remain constant throughout the site. The home page template will place the a sub-level navigation menu in the right-hand column, with the main container taking up 2/3 of the page, hosting a graphic image to draw the user’s attention. Other pages within the website will maintain a static header, with the main site navigation menu available, and the right-hand navigation menu hosting links to other pages within that section of the site. This will allow for more screen real estate to be devoted to the artist’s work. The design on the additional site pages will allow the artist work to be highlighted, but also allow for quick and easy access to related information. For the Polar Clan Initiative website, the color palette is be subdued. The purpose of the website is to showcase the work of the members similar to an online gallery setting. White boxes to highlight the work of artists, with cool neutral blues, greys, and black. These colors will not only mimic the colors of the polar bear’s environment but will also allow a natural gallery for the photos. Using a neutral blue, grey, and black will allow for typography to be applied on top of background images for better visibility. Highlight colors will be driven by the featured artist’s work, this will allow for the visual appeal to be inspired by the product and allow the website colors to be a supporting cast.
